Competing Chefs to blend their #owntea
Chefs participating in the Canadian Culinary Championship at Gold Medal Plates this coming weekend have been invited to blend their own tea; as have 12 Judges, including James Chatto and Perry Bentley From UBC-O and 4 Olympians; namely, Gold, two time Silver and Bronze Medalist, Adam van Koeverden; as well as Gold Medalists Jamie Sale, Kristi Richards and Kelsey Serwa. 'We thought it would be fun and a great way to contribute to our Canadian Olympians' ~ co-founder Pierre Piche
The participants were given a list of ingredients to choose from, including green tea, rooibos, mint, lavender and orange peel and asked to concoct their very own tea blend. The completed teas, all 23 of them, will be signed and auctioned off during the Gold Medal Plate finale this Saturday, being held at The Delta Grand Okanagan. The monies raised at the auction will go towards supporting the Canadian Olympic athletes. Guests of the Culinary Championship will have an opportunity to taste some of these teas over the weekend and those attending the finale will each receive a sample of tea and a chance to win a Lyon Inspired Tea Party with Celebrity Chef Michael Lyon.
